JLPT N5 Exam Details

Japanese-Language Proficiency Test — Level N5

Administered by Japan Foundation and Japan Educational Exchanges and Services (JEES)

Official Source
Overall pass mark: 80 out of 180 points. Sectional pass marks: Language Knowledge + Reading must score at least 38 out of 120; Listening must score at least 19 out of 60. Both the overall and all sectional minimums must be met simultaneously.

Fees vary by country and host institution; in Australia approximately AUD $95 (2026); in the Philippines approximately PHP 1,800 for N5. There is no single global fee — check the local host institution in your test city.
Exam Fee
Study time: 3–4 months of consistent daily study (approximately 150–200 hours total) for learners starting from zero Japanese knowledge.

Exam Content Breakdown

Based on the official Japan Foundation and Japan Educational Exchanges and Services (JEES) content outline

Language Knowledge — Vocabulary30%

Kanji reading (hiragana/katakana conversion), orthography (writing words in kanji or kana), contextual word selection. Tests approximately 800 N5-level vocabulary words and 100 basic kanji.

Language Knowledge — Grammar20%

Grammatical form selection (particles, verb conjugations, adjective forms), sentence construction/reordering (★ star-mark questions), and text-flow coherence questions.

Reading Comprehension15%

Short passage comprehension (~80 characters), medium passage comprehension (~250 characters), and information retrieval from practical materials such as notices, menus, schedules, and advertisements.

Listening Comprehension35%

Task-based comprehension (listen to dialogue + select image/action), key-point comprehension (identify critical information), verbal expressions (matching audio to illustrations), and quick response (choose appropriate short reply).
